Abstract
An organic light emitting element produced by using a light emitting composition that contains both a first compound having a PBHT value more than 0.730 and a second compound having Elower than that of the first compound and ΔEless than 0.20 eV is excellent in durability. Eis the lowest excited singlet energy level, ΔEis the difference between the lowest excited singlet energy level and the lowest excited triplet energy level.
